| 20090011582 | Method for Depositing a Vapour Deposition Material - Method for depositing a vapour deposition material on a base material, in particular for doping a semiconductor material, in which a vapour deposition batch, in which the vapour deposition material is enclosed in an air-tight manner by a shell, is introduced into a vapour deposition chamber and the shell is opened in the vapour deposition chamber, so that the vapour deposition material in the vapour deposition chamber then evaporates and is deposited on the base material, wherein the shell is opened by at least partially melting by heating a meltable shell material which at least partially forms the shell at a melting temperature which is lower than an evaporation temperature of the vapour deposition material. | 01-08-2009 |

| 20090230844 | LIGHT-EMITTING COMPONENT - The invention relates to a light-emitting component, in particular organic light-emitting diode, having an electrode and a counterelectrode and an organic region—arranged between the electrode and the counterelectrode—with a light-emitting organic region, which comprises an emission layer and a further emission layer and which, upon application of an electrical voltage to the electrode and the counterelectrode, is formed in a manner emitting light in a plurality of colour ranges in the visible spectral range, optionally through to white light, in which case the emission layer comprises a fluorescent emitter which emits light predominantly in the blue or in the blue-green spectral range; the further emission layer comprises one or a plurality of phosphorescent emitters emitting light predominantly in the non-blue spectral range; a triplet energy for an energy level of a triplet state of the fluorescent emitter in the emission layer is greater than a triplet energy for an energy level of a triplet state of the phosphorescent emitter in the further emission layer; and an at least 5% proportion of the light generated in the light-emitting organic region is formed in the visible spectral range as fluorescent light from singlet states of the fluorescent emitter in the emission layer. | 09-17-2009 |
| 20090267490 | TRANSPARENT LIGHT-EMITTING COMPONENT - The invention relates to a transparent light-emitting component, in particular organic light-emitting diode, having a transparent layer arrangement in which are formed, on a substrate in a stack, planar electrodes and an organic region arranged between the planar electrodes, which organic region comprises a light-emitting layer, made from one or a plurality of organic materials. For at least one direction of incidence, a transmittance of the transparent layer arrangement for at least one wavelength subrange in the visible spectral range is greater than 50%. One of the planar electrodes has a metal layer having a thickness of less than 40 nm, and another of the planar electrodes, which is arranged opposite to the electrode in the layer arrangement, has an oxide layer made from an electrically conductive oxide material having a thickness of at least 10 nm, an intensity ratio of at least 2:1 being formed for a light emission emerging on one side of the transparent layer arrangement and a light emission emerging on an opposite side of the transparent layer arrangement. | 10-29-2009 |

| 20090309492 | Organic Light Emitting Component, and Production Method - The invention relates to an organic light emitting component, particularly an organic light emitting diode, in which an arrangement is formed that comprises a bottom electrode, a top electrode, and an organic layer region which is located between and is in electrical contact with the bottom electrode and the top electrode and contains at least one hole transport layer, at least one electron transport layer, and a light-emitting area. The bottom electrode is formed from a dispersion as a structured, binder-free, and optically transparent bottom electrode layer made of a bottom electrode material by means of a wet chemical application process, said bottom electrode material being an optically transparent, electrically conductive oxide. The bottom electrode layer has a sheet resistance of less than about 500 Ω/square and an optical refractive index of less than 1.8. | 12-17-2009 |
